Battle Mode Types

Arena Rumble

The goal of Arena Rumble is to reduce your opponent's health to 0.

Sky Goals

Carry the electric football through the goal posts to score 7 points, or throw the ball through the goal to score 3 points. Damage your opponent to make them fumble the ball.

SkyGem Master

Collect five SkyGems before your opponent does to win SkyGem Master. Single gems fall from the sky periodically. Damaging your opponent will cause them to drop some of their gems. Once they're on the ground, any Skylander can grab them.
